    Definitely nothing to be worried about!

    Copies of all the rubbish letters the registered keeper of the car will receive from NCP are shown on this thread:

    http://forums.moneysavingexpert.com/showthread.html?t=2214803

    Show your friend the link to the NCP letters so she can see and be ready for each letter. The letters talk about Court Action can look a bit scary if you are not ready for them - but once you know it's just a standard letter-chain that will just fizzle out without Court or any effect on your credit rating then you can happily receive each one and file/ignore it.

    She must not write to them or appeal or anything - they don't allow appeals, it's just part of the scam for them to get more info and try to find out who was driving. Not that NCP then ever take anyone to Court anyway, even if they know who was driving, they still send the same old letters and then stop.

    It's a very predictable scam. Make sure your friend understands the score and doesn't pay.
